Aspects Influencing Private Psychiatrist Prices
Private psychiatrist prices can differ considerably based upon several factors. Comprehending these elements can assist clients make informed choices concerning their [Mental Health Referral](https://yppakcan.com/author/best-ways-to-improve-mental-health8576/) healthcare.
1. Geographical Location
The cost of psychiatric services frequently varies by region. 2. Experience and Expertise
Psychiatrists with innovative experience, specializations, or credentials might charge higher charges. For instance, a psychiatrist who has actually gone through substantial training in specific mental health conditions may have higher rates than a family doctor.
3. Kind Of Service Provided
The nature of the services required can considerably impact pricing. Preliminary assessments, medication management, therapy sessions, and follow-up consultations can vary in cost. Typically, preliminary assessments may be priced greater than routine follow-up visits.
4. Period of Sessions
The length of each visit likewise affects expenses. 5. Insurance Coverage
Clients with private medical insurance might find that their plans cover a portion of the psychiatrist's costs. Patients are encouraged to validate their insurance benefits prior to looking for care.
6. Session Frequency
Patients might require varying frequencies of sessions based on their treatment plans. More frequent appointments may sustain greater costs over time, whereas less regular sessions might be more economical.

While expenses can vary commonly, an understanding of average pricing can offer a clearer perspective.
Preliminary Consultations: These generally range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 600 depending upon the elements discussed.Follow-Up Appointments: The costs for subsequent sessions typically v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300.Medication Management: This can be billed per session or as part of follow-up care, typically falling between ₤ 150 to ₤ 250.Restorative Sessions: If therapy is included, rates might range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 for each session.Payment Methods

Will my insurance coverage cover the cost of seeing a private psychiatrist?
This largely depends on your insurance service provider and specific strategy. It is advisable to inspect your mental health benefits.
Are there any extra expenses I should consider?
Yes, clients ought to think about expenses related to prescriptions, additional therapy sessions, or other diagnostic tests, which might not be included in the preliminary check out charge.
Can I negotiate charges with my psychiatrist?
Some psychiatrists might use moving scale costs based on earnings, and it's worth discussing this possibility at your preliminary consultation.
How can I find an economical private psychiatrist?
Research study local service providers, seek recommendations, validate insurance protection, and ask about moving scale payments or neighborhood health programs.
